Content area

Abstract

Due to the highly dynamic feature, dependable workflow scheduling is critical in the Grid environment. Various scheduling algorithms have been proposed, but seldom consider the resource reliability. Current Grid systems mainly exploit fault tolerance mechanism to guarantee the dependable workflow execution, which, however, wastes system resources. The paper proposes a dependable Grid workflow scheduling system (called DGWS). It introduces a Markov Chain-based resource availability prediction model. Based on the model, a reliability cost driven workflow scheduling algorithm is presented. The performance evaluation results, including the simulation on both parametric randomly generated DAGs and two real scientific workflow applications, demonstrate that compared to present workflow scheduling algorithms, DGWS improves the success ratio of tasks and diminishes the makespan of workflow, so improves the dependability of workflow execution in the dynamic Grid environments.

Details

Title
Dependable Grid Workflow Scheduling Based on Resource Availability
Author
Yongcai Tao 1 ; Jin, Hai 2 ; Wu, Song 2 ; Shi, Xuanhua 2 ; Shi, Lei 1 

 School of Information Engineering, Zhengzhou University, Zhengzhou, Henan, China 
 Services Computing Technology and System Lab, Cluster and Grid Computing Lab, Huazhong University of Science and Technology, Wuhan, China 
Pages
47-61
Publication year
2013
Publication date
Mar 2013
Publisher
Springer Nature B.V.
ISSN
15707873
e-ISSN
15729184
Source type
Scholarly Journal
Language of publication
English
ProQuest document ID
2259770773
Copyright
Journal of Grid Computing is a copyright of Springer, (2012). All Rights Reserved.